Mobile Gambling Trends in Australia – A Practical Guide for 2024

Australian players are moving faster onto smartphones, and the market is responding with slick apps, instant‑pay deposits and live‑streamed casino tables. The surge is driven by better mobile networks, a growing appetite for sports betting on‑the‑go, and regulators tightening standards around security and responsible gambling.

In practice, this means you’ll see more “download‑free” web‑apps that feel like native apps, richer welcome bonus offers that can be claimed straight from your phone, and faster verification processes that finish while you sip a coffee.

Bonuses and Wagering Requirements on Mobile Devices

Mobile‑only promotions are on the rise. Operators reward players who download the app with a special welcome bonus – often a 100% match on the first deposit up to AU$500, plus a handful of free spins on a popular slot. However, the fine print matters: most offers come with wagering requirements of 30x the bonus amount.

If you’re a beginner, look for a “low‑roll” bonus where the wagering is capped at 20x and the games contributing to the roll‑over have a higher RTP. That way you can clear the requirement without chasing high‑volatility titles that drain your bankroll.

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ed for Mobile Players

Australians favour familiar deposit routes – credit/debit cards, PayPal, and newer services like PayID or POLi. These methods are usually instant, letting you fund your mobile casino balance in seconds. When it comes to withdrawals, the fastest options are e‑wallets and direct bank transfers, often processed within 24 hours.

Below is a quick comparison of the most common mobile‑friendly payment methods used by licensed Australian casinos:

Method Deposit Speed Withdrawal Speed Typical Fees
Credit / Debit Card Instant 1–3 business days None to $2 per transaction
PayPal / e‑wallet Instant Same‑day to 24 hours Usually free
PayID / POLi Instant 1–2 business days Free

Registration, Verification and KYC on Mobile Apps

Signing up on a mobile casino is now a three‑step process: enter your email, set a password, and verify your identity. Most platforms use the “instant ID” feature – you snap a photo of your driver’s licence and the system cross‑checks it against government databases.

While this adds a tiny delay, it dramatically improves security and prevents fraud. If you’re worried about privacy, check that the casino encrypts data with SSL and holds an Australian licence – that’s a solid indicator of safe play.

App vs Browser – Which Mobile Experience Is Right for You?

If you prefer a dedicated icon on your home screen, an app usually delivers smoother graphics, push‑notifications for bonus alerts, and faster load times. However, a modern responsive browser version can be just as powerful, especially if you travel abroad and need to avoid app store restrictions.

Both options support the same core features – deposit methods, live casino streams, and sports betting – but the app often provides exclusive promotions, such as a “mobile‑only free bet” on the weekend’s big match.
